Ingredients

For the Fettuccine

  • 8 ounces fettuccine pasta

For the Chicken

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1 pound)
  • Salt and pepper to taste, ensuring even seasoning throughout the chicken for enhanced flavor.
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il, a high-quality extra virgin olive oil can elevate the dish with its rich flavor.

For the Garlic Butter Sauce

  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, allowing you to control the saltiness of the sauce.
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ced to release its aromatic oils and flavor; more garlic can be added for garlic lovers!
  • 1 cup heavy cream, which gives the sauce its rich texture; you can opt for half-and-half for a lighter version.
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ese, preferably freshly grated for superior melting and flavor; avoid pre-grated options if possible!
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ning (optional), adding a nice herbal note to the dish; feel free to use fresh herbs if available.
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ish), adding a pop of color and freshness to the final presentation.

Step-by-Step Instructions

Cook the Fettuccine: In a large pot of boiling salted water, cook the fettuccine according to package instructions until al dente, usually about 8-10 minutes. Stir occasionally to prevent sticking. Reserve 1 cup of pasta water before draining to adjust the sauce’s consistency later. Al dente pasta should be firm to the bite, ensuring the ideal texture for our sauce.

Prepare the Chicken: While the pasta cooks, season both sides of the chicken breasts with salt and pepper. This step is crucial for ensuring the chicken is flavorful.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ering, which indicates it’s hot enough for cooking. You might hear a slight sizzle when the chicken hits the pan, which is a good sign!

Cook the Chicken: Add the chicken breasts to the skillet and cook for 6-7 minutes on each side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C) and the chicken is golden brown. The golden color indicates a delicious crust. Remove from the skillet and let rest for a few minutes before slicing to retain the juices. This resting period is key to achieving juicy chicken.

Make the Sauce: In the same skillet, reduce the heat to medium and add the butter. Once melted, stir in the minced garlic and sauté for about 1 minute, or until fragrant, being careful not to burn the garlic. The aroma at this stage will be heavenly, filling your kitchen with warmth!

Add Cream: Pour in the heavy cream, stirring continuously to create a smooth blend. Let it simmer for about 3-4 minutes until it thickens slightly, causing the flavors to meld beautifully. You’ll know the sauce is ready when it coats the back of a spoon.

Incorporate Parmesan: Gradually whisk in the grated Parmesan cheese and Italian seasoning (if using). Continue to stir until the cheese is fully melted and the sauce is creamy. If the sauce is too thick, mix in some reserved pasta water until the desired consistency is reached; this should be creamy but not overly heavy. The cheese adds a depth of flavor that elevates this Garlic Parmesan Chicken Fettuccine even further!

Combine Ingredients: Add the drained fettuccine to the skillet, tossing to fully coat the pasta in the garlic butter sauce. Slice the cooked chicken and lay it on top of the pasta for an appealing presentation. Make sure every strand of fettuccine is covered in that delicious sauce it’s what makes this dish so irresistible!

Garnish and Serve: Sprinkle with freshly chopped parsley for a touch of color and flavor. Serve immediately, enjoying the creamy chicken pasta goodness! Tips & Tricks

  • Don’t Skip the Resting Time: Allowing the chicken to rest after cooking keeps it juicy and tender, ensuring each bite is moist and flavorful.
  • Customize the Sauce: Feel free to add vegetables like spinach or sun-dried tomatoes for added flavor and nutrition. Check out our Sun Dried Tomato Chicken Skillet for inspiration! You could also add a pinch of red pepper flakes for a spicy kick. The beauty of this dish is in its versatility.
  • Storage Tips: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at gently in a skillet, adding a splash of cream or pasta water as needed to maintain creaminess. It’s best enjoyed freshly made, but the leftovers are still delicious! You can also consider freezing the sauce separately for a quick meal later.
  • Make Ahead: You can prepare the sauce in advance and store it in the refrigerator. Just reheat it when you’re ready to serve, but be sure to add a bit of cream or pasta water to revive its creamy texture. This makes weeknight dinners a breeze!
  • Cooking Techniques: Use a pasta fork to help combine the pasta with the sauce without breaking the fettuccine. Tossing the pasta in the sauce ensures that every strand is perfectly coated and flavorful. For an added touch of elegance, you might consider topping it with freshly cracked black pepper!
